How much is the price of teeth whitening?

Whitening your teeth is one way to make you feel better about yourself with a more shiny smile and a better appearance. If you want a little change there are over-the-counter options for teeth whitening in many stores but if you want your teeth to be as white as pearl you can ask your dentist for a professional teeth whitening. Although there is a huge difference between the pricing of the products for teeth whitening that you can purchase from the market and the professional teeth whitening, the result is also a huge difference, It is safer and it will last longer.

Teeth whitening is more effective on natural teeth, but less on dentures or crown teeth. It is safe although it might cause some temporary sensitivity after. The cost varies according to the type of whitening method that you choose. Many dentists offer polyclinic treatments for teeth whitening. Teeth whitening with hydrogen peroxide

Your dentist will prepare your teeth by cleaning the plaques and residues using hydrogen peroxide.  After that, they will apply a plastic protector to protect and keep your lips and cheeks away from your teeth. They will also use a gel to protect your gums from the whitening solution.

When your teeth are ready your dentist will apply a hydrogen peroxide gel to them. Then they will let it stay on your teeth for a certain time, normally around 15-30 minutes. After the end of this period, they will remove the gel and they can apply the second dose. You might not get your desired result after the first session and may need to repeat the treatment and may need to plan another appointment. Every session will approximately last around one hour.

Teeth whitening treatment with laser

To increase the effectiveness of hydrogen peroxide some whitening treatments include laser use. For this also your dentist will clean your teeth and prepare them the same way as for the hydrogen peroxide method. They will apply a protector to your cheek and then apply the whitening gel and after that, they will use a laser or special lighting on your teeth.

Your dentist will arrange 15 minutes for the gel and the laser to stay on your teeth. after this they will control the whiteness of your teeth. During one visit you may need to repeat the whitening process two or three times.

Your visit to the dentist will take around one hour.  After that, your dentist will give you some equipment for you to apply for a couple of days at home for completing the whitening process.

Teeth whitening treatment with Deep bleaching 

Basically, this technique known as Deep whitening is generally a method that is performed by every dentist. Especially if you need intensive treatment for removing the stains on your teeth, you can try the deep bleaching method. In this process, your dentist will make your teeth ready by polishing your teeth with an abrasive substance such as pumice powder. This makes the surface of your teeth more receptive to the treatment. After this, your dentist will apply a whitening solution using special placing pieces on your teeth.

These pieces and the gel will stay in your mouth for 20 minutes. After that, your dentist will perform the second application for another 20 minutes. Then, you need to continue the treatment for 14 days with the instruction you will be given to applying at home. After the cycle of home treatment, you need to visit the dentist for another session. You will need to continue the home treatment every few weeks to maintain the result. Your dentist will let you know how often the treatment is needed for you to do.

Dental Veneers

If you didn’t get the result that you needed after the whitening treatment, you may need to consider more comprehensive treatment such as a dental veneer. Your dentist will place a permanent crust on top of the surface of your teeth. If your dentist is using a special system, to make these parts you have to visit the clinic to get a mold of your teeth. Sometimes With different methods, dentists use ready-made parts. This cover will give your smile a whole different look.

Teeth whitening with prescription at home

Some dentists offer teeth whitening kits for home. Using these kits and these types of treatments might take longer than the treatments applied in dental clinics; however, some patients prefer them more. Your dentist will tell you how long you need to use the kit, mostly from one to two weeks for better results.
